St. Charles, Michigan

Beloved mother went home to be with the Lord on Saturday, October 25, 2025. Age 81 years. The daughter of the late John A. and Marjune M. (Mikula) Kushion, Sally was born on December 25, 1943, in Saginaw, Michigan. She graduated from St. Charles High School. Sally continued her education and graduated from Northwood University. She married the love of her life, Robert J. Mentus, on August 8, 1964. Sally loved and adored him for many wonderful years. He preceded her on February 7, 2006. Sally found great joy in being a homemaker and caring for her family. She loved life on the farm, where she could sew, garden, and nurture both her home and the land with skill and passion.

Surviving are her daughter, Shanda Mentus; brothers-in-law, Wilfred Hoeppner, Frank Mentus, Jack (Kay) Mentus; nieces and nephew, Kerri (Shawn) Sny, Tim (Shannon) Mentus, Ann (Jim) Buffa; great-nieces, Ella and Penelope Sny; very dear friends, Tracy Oszust and Jacob Ozust. Also surviving are many extended family members and loved ones. Besides her husband and her parents; Sally was preceded in death by her son, Scott Mentus; an infant granddaughter, Lauryn Mentus; sister, Pamela Hoeppner; sister-in-law, Millie Mentus; and nephew, Joshua Stoddard.

Committal service will take place at 3:00 p.m. on Wednesday, October 29, 2025, at Fremont Township Cemetery, Loven Rd, Hemlock, MI. Funeral arrangements have been entrusted to W. L. Case and Company Funeral Directors, 4480 Mackinaw Rd, Saginaw, MI 48603. Those planning an expression of sympathy may wish to consider memorials to Amazing Grace Animal Rescue.
